About this design:
It started with a stone circle with chocolately brown and topaz stripes, and two flat disc brown and gold circle beads - I'm not sure of their material but they're very light (maybe resin?).
The assymetrical sides feature dulI gold seed and shiny bronze seed beads, wood or bamboo beads (the latter were also used in the previous project, number 27), and Czech fire polish beads in a golden amber and a smoky brown.
The necklace is strung on 10lb brown hemp cord, with gunmetal wire wraps, antique brass jump rings, brass chain and an antique copper toggle clasp.
Heavy metal indeed.
Components:
Stone circle pendant, brown and gold disc beads (maybe resin), bamboo or wood beads, dull gold seed beads, bronze seed beads, Czech fire polish beads, 10 lb brown hemp cord, gunmetal wire 22 gauge, antique gold jump rings, brass chain, antique bronze toggle.Read the comments (or add your own)
